32, Wilfield Road, Sandymount, Dublin 4, D04 FD29

Retention of a first-floor rear extension and permission for a new front vehicular entrance and parking space.

3870/19 · Dublin City Council · Lodged 27 August 2019

Development description

Permission & retention: retention permission sought for extension at first floor level to the rear and permission sought for new vehicular entrance in front wall + railings and the provision of parking space to front of existing house.
